A Few Points on a Smart (or Senseable) City
Smart is the new 'green'. Smart city, smart transport, smart buildings - the label smart is now often used and abused. After reviewing the principles behind the 'smart city' concept - which Carlo prefers to call 'senseable city', this presentation will discuss ten areas of innovative applications. From transport to energy to civic engagement, something that could be called a decalogue for a senseable/smart city.
An architect and engineer by training, Carlo Ratti practices in Italy and directs the MIT Senseable City Lab. He graduated from the Politecnico di Torino and the École Nationale des Ponts et Chaussées in Paris, and later earned his MPhil and PhD at the University of Cambridge, UK. Carlo holds several patents and has co-authored over 200 publications. Forbes listed him as one of the ‘Names You Need To Know’ in 2011 and Fast Company named him as one of the ’50 Most Influential Designers in America’. He was also featured in Wired Magazine’s ‘Smart List 2012: 50 people who will change the world’.

PHILIPP RODEExecutive DirectorLSE Cities
Going Green: How Cities are Leading the Next Economy
Going Green: How cities are leading the next economy is research based on a major global survey of 90 city governments and a case study analysis of innovative green strategies in eight cities. The survey was conducted by LSE Cities, ICLEI – local governments for sustainability and the Global Green Growth Institute (GGGI), in order to closely analyse the strengths and weaknesses of cities as key contributors to the emerging green economy.
Going Green offers a fresh perspective on the environmental challenges that cities face, along with the opportunities and barriers to going green and fostering economic growth. The survey covers key aspects of green policies and the green economy, smart city technology, green policy assessment and urban governance. It provides a comprehensive overview of the experiences of cities around the world as they make the transition to a green economy.
Philipp Rode is Executive Director of LSE Cities and Senior Research Fellow at the London School of Economics and Political Science. He is Ove Arup Fellow with the LSE Cities Programme and co-convenes the LSE Sociology Course on ‘City Making: The Politics of Urban Form’. As researcher and consultant he manages interdisciplinary projects comprising urban governance, transport, city planning and urban design. Rode organised Urban Age conferences in partnership with Deutsche Bank’s Alfred Herrhausen Society in ten cities bringing together political leaders, city mayors, urban practitioners, private sector representatives and academic experts.
FABIO GRAMAZIOChair for Architecture and Digital FabricationETH Zurich
Digital Materiality in Architecture
Fabio Gramazio will lecture about Digital Materiality, a term describing an emergent transformation in the expression of architecture. Materiality is increasingly being enriched with digital characteristics, which substantially affect architecture’s physis. Digital materiality evolves through the interplay between digital and material processes in design and construction. The synthesis of two seemingly distinct worlds – the digital and the material – generates new, self-evident realities. Data and material, programming and construction are interwoven. This synthesis is enabled by the techniques of digital fabrication, which allows the architect to control the manufacturing process through design data. Material is thus enriched by information; material becomes “informed.” In the future, architects’ ideas will permeate the fabrication process in its entirety. This new situation transforms the possibilities and thus the professional scope of the architect. Fabio Gramazio is an architect with multi-disciplinary interests ranging from computational design and robotic fabrication to material innovation. In 2000, he founded the architecture practice Gramazio & Kohler in conjunction with his partner Matthias Kohler, where numerous award-wining designs have been realized, integrating novel architectural designs into a contemporary building culture. Trained at the Swiss Federal Institute of Technology ETH Zurich, his integral approach to practice and research focuses on the interplay of digital design and material processes through advanced construction methodologies. Since 2005, Gramazio & Kohler have held the Chair for Architecture and Digital Fabrication at the Swiss Federal Institute of Technology ETH Zurich. Founding the world’s first architectural robotic laboratory, the pioneering investigations of Fabio Gramazio concentrate on non-standardized architectural design and additive fabrication processes through the customized use of industrial robots. A significant amount of research has been accomplished addressing scales ranging from 1:1 prototypical installations to the design of robotically fabricated high-rise buildings. Currently Fabio Gramazio’s research is focusing on adaptive design strategies for constructive material systems and in-situ robotic fabrication.

DAVID BENJAMINFounding PrincipalThe Living
Now We See Now
Cities are living, breathing organisms. In the context of new technologies and new urban challenges, there is a great opportunity to create new living, breathing design ecosystems. These design ecosystems will link complex flows of people, resources, data, and energy. They will involve work on multiple scales simultaneously. They will anticipate and welcome rapid change. Within these new design ecosystems, architects and technologists will have to embrace design with uncertainty, design with shifting and unknowable forces, and design without complete control. This talk will explore examples of these design ecosystems. It will describe a series of projects and prototypes that draw on sensor data, generative algorithms, digital simulation, automated fabrication, and synthetic biology to create buildings and cities that are more adaptive, regenerative, and alive.
David Benjamin is Founding Principal of The Living and Director of the Living Architecture Lab at Columbia University. The Living creates full-scale, functioning prototypes of the architecture of the future. Clients include the City of New York, Seoul Municipal Government, Airbus, Autodesk, Nike, 3M, Kanye West, and Eyebeam Center for Art and Technology. Recent projects include Living City (a platform for buildings to talk to one another), Amphibious Architecture (a cloud of light above the East River that changes color according to water quality), and Architecture Bio-synthesis (a new process for bio-computation and bio-manufacturing of high-performance building materials through synthetic biology).
GILLES RETSINCo-FounderSoftKill Design
Testing the Boundaries of Large-Scale 3D Printing
Gilles Retsin will present SoftKill Design's prototype for a 3D printed house. The prototype investigates the architectural potential of the latest additive manufacturing technologies, testing the boundaries of large scale 3D printing by designing with computer algorithms that micro-organize the printed material itself. The Softkill house is the first project to move away from heavy, compression based 3d printing of on-site buildings, instead proposing lightweight, high resolution, optimised structures which, at life scale, are manageable truck-sized pieces that can be printed off site and later assembled on site. The presentation will further speculate on how new computational design methodologies and advanced fabrication techniques could radically change the way we build the cities of the future.
Gilles Retsin is a London based architect holding a Masters in Architecture + Urbanism (Dist) from the Architectural Association School of Architecture’s Design Research Laboratory (AA.DRL).He is co- founder of SoftKill Design, a collective design studio with Nicholette Chan, Aaron Silver and Sophia Tang, investigating generative design methodologies for additive manufacturing. He is lecturer at the University of East London and runs a research cluster investigating 3D printing strategies for architecture at University College London. He also teaches for the AA in Shanghai and Beijing, focusing on computational design methodologies for the new mega-city. SoftKill Design has succesfully prorotyped one of the world’s first coherent designs prototypes for a completely 3d printed house. The work of SoftKill Design has been widely published, most notably in Wired, Dezeen and The Observer.
SAM HILLCo-Founder,PAN Studio
Hello Lamp Post
In 2014 PAN Studio launched Hello Lamp Post – an 8 week, city-wide installation across Bristol, commissioned by Watershed Art Trust for the Playable City Award. Hello Lamppost brought thousands of objects across the city to life – including (but not limited to) post boxes, lamp posts, bus stops and parking meters. By referencing the existing identifier codes seen on these items of street furniture, the people of Bristol could converse back and forth with objects via text message. The project served as a platform that encouraged people to share their observations, memories and opinions of city locations.

FRAUKE BEHRENDTSenior LecturerUniversity of Brighton
Smart E-Bikes Research - How Urban E-Cycling and Media Mobilities could Shape Future Sustainable Cities
The 'Smart e-Bikes' project considers how electrically-assisted bikes could significantly widen the appeal of cycling in the UK and how e-bikes could be integrated with media mobilities. The 'Smart e-bike Monitoring System' (SEMS) developed on the project is currently running on a fleet of 35 e-bikes in Brighton (UK). It is an open-source platform for the acquisition of usage data from electric bicycles that can monitor location, rider control data and other custom sensor input in real time. The data can be viewed by riders and analysed for research. SEMS can be extended with other sensors to address various issues in e-bike research and sustainable urban mobility. http://www.smart-ebikes.co.uk Dr Frauke Behrendt leads the 3-year RCUK funded 'Smart e-bikes' research project ( http://www.smart-ebikes.co.uk ) that aims to understand how people engage with electrically-assisted cycling and the issues for policy, design/product development and research that could lead to a higher uptake of e-bikes in the UK. The project, which runs from 2011 – 2014, has developed an open-source monitoring system (SEMS) for a fleet of 35 e-bikes that enables collection and sharing of ride and sensor data in real time. Behrendt is a Senior Lecturer at the University of Brighton and her research interests include the areas of digital cultures, sound studies, mobility, (sonic) interaction design, sustainable development and smart cities. www.fraukebehrendt.com

ERIK SCHLANGENChair of Experimental MicromechanicsDelft University of Technology
Enhancing Structural Durability and Sustainability by using Self-Healing Material Concepts
Civil engineering structures are designed to have a long service life. During the life time of the structure some level of degradation of the used materials will always take place leading to damage in the structure. In this presentation self-healing concepts for civil engineering materials will be introduced. Various ways of implementing self-healing for concrete and asphalt will be explained. Furthermore the benefits for durability, sustainability and economics of our infrastructures will be discussed and illustrated with real examples. Dr. Erik Schlangen is Professor in the chair of “Experimental Micromechanics” at the faculty of Civil Engineering and Geosciences at Delft University of Technology in the Netherlands. He is also the director of the Microlab for micromechanical and material research which is part of the same University. Prior to joining Delft University he was a senior materials engineer at the materials research institute Intron in the Netherlands. He has a MSc-degree in Structural Engineering from Eindhoven University of Technology and a PhD from Delft University, where he graduated in 1993. He is specialized in fracture mechanics of quasi-brittle materials like concrete, durability mechanics, finite element modelling, design of experimental techniques and self-healing of concrete and asphalt. He is the inventor of the Delft lattice model for simulation of fracture. He owns a patent on healable concrete. He initiated the self-healing bacterial concrete and is the inventor of the self-healing asphalt with steel-wool and induction heating that is applied in several applications. He is very active in RILEM committees and is chairman of the Technical Committee dealing with self-healing phenomena of cement-based materials.
ANDREW HUDSON-SMITHDirector, Centre for Advanced Spatial Analysis (CASA) at The BartlettUniversity College London
Realtime Data, Augmented and Virtual Reality mixed with The Internet of Things: Towards the Smart Citizen and ultimately a Smart City
Every day, we create 2.5 quintillion bytes of data — so much that 90% of the data in the world today has been created in the last two years alone. This data comes from everywhere: sensors used to gather climate information, posts to social media sites, digital pictures and videos, purchase transaction records, and cell phone GPS signals to name a few (IBM, 2103). This data can, compared to traditional data sources, be defined as ‘big’. Cities and urban environments are the main sources for big data, every minute 100,000 tweets are sent globally, Google receives 2,000,000 search requests and users share 684,478 pieces of content on Facebook (Mashable, 2012). An increasingly amount of this data stream is geolocated, from Check-ins via Foursquare through to Tweets and searches via Google Now, the data cities and individuals emit can be collected and viewed to make the data city visible, aiding our understanding of now only how urban systems operate but opening up the possibility of a real-time view of the city at large (Hudson-Smith, 2014). The talk explores systems such as The City Dashboard (http://www.citydashboard.org) and the rise of the Internet of Things (IoT) in terms of data collection, visualization and analysis. Joining these up creates a move towards the Smart City and via innovations in IoT a look towards augmented reality pointing towards the the creation of a 'Smart Citizen' and ultimately a Smart City.

ALLISON DRINGCo-Founderelegant embellishments
Ornament and Climate
prosolve370e is a decorative facade module that reduces air pollution in cities. When coupled with architectural surfaces, the modular system can grow to effectively counter local pollution hot-spots. The modules' forms are devised to increase the efficacy of the photocatalytic technology, employing surface enlargement for better reception of light. prosolve370e was recently installed on a hospital facade in Mexico City.
prosolve, along with another project: a consumer plastic synthesized from atmospheric CO2, represent a new materialization of climatic condition. These materials signify existing but often immaterial conditions that increasingly have impact on the way we live. Allison Dring is an architect and co-founder of elegant embellishments, an architectural start-up with the strategy of self-initiating projects for condition-specific spaces.
Along with Daniel Schwaag, she initiated and produced proSolve370e, a decorative, three-dimensional module that reduces air pollution in cities. The modules were recently installed on the facade of hospital Torre de Especialidades in Mexico City. prosolve370e has been exhibited at the Venice Architecture Biennale, and acquired by the Smithsonian Cooper-Hewitt, National Design Museum as part of the permanent collection.
ENRICO DINIChairmanD-Shape
Every Building is A Prototype - Large Scale 3D Printing in Building Construction
In this talk, Enrico will describe introduce the D-SHAPE technology through the history of his inventing process since the first trials to the latest developments introducing the concept of Archinature,as the final outcome of his exploration.
Enrico Dini is an Italian civil engineer who spent most of his career in automation and robotics for the footwear industry. Since the late 90’s Enrico came into contact with rapid prototyping techniques used to facilitate the design of the shoes. In 2003, while he was 3D printing a shoe sole, Enrico had a vision of this technique applied on a large scale and imagined a new free form architecture. Enrico decided to return to its original skill enriched by his experience in robotics and since then has devoted his life to developing a new construction technique based on the principles of stereolitograpy. In 2007 helped from his trusted brother Riccardo, Enrico tested successfully his large scale D-Shape printer prototype and the following year he printed the Radiolaria, the first free-form building structure ever. Today Enrico Dini is immersed in developing D-Shape, 3D Printing Building technology to bring innovation to the architecture and construction industries.

CLAUDIA PASQUEROCo-FounderecoLogicStudio
Sythesizing Renewable Energies into Food & Power
The Bio Urban Design Lab promotes a non anthropocentric understanding of the urban landscape, intended as a territory of self-organization and co-evolution of multiple systems, and prefigures a future bio-active city able to synthesize renewable energies into food and power as well as wastes into raw material for construction and growth. On one side we research bio-mimetic models of self-organization to develop adaptive urban planning strategies, while on the other we investigate the integration of bio-technological and digital communication systems for re-metabolising the urban fabric. The lecture introduces how social insects like ants can become valuable models of bottom up and adaptive design of new urban agriculture networks, and how urban microalgae can be grown in a new breed of digitally augmented "cyber-Gardens", installed in London, Paris, Milan and the Osterlin region of Sweden.
Claudia is an architect, engineer, author and educator. Claudia is co-founder of ecoLogicStudio and she has completed a public library in Turin, a Shopping Mall’s eco-roof in Milan among other projects. Claudia work investigates the boundaries between architecture, science and tradition; it has been exhibited at the Venice Architectural Biennale in 2006, in 2008, in 2010 and in ArchiLab 2014. Claudia has been Unit Master at the AA in London, Visiting Critic in Cornell University, Ithaca, NY and she is currently an academic at IAAC, Barcelona as well as academic stream leader of the MArch in Urban Morphogenesis and BIO-UD cluster director at the Bartlett UCL in London. The Book ‘Systemic Architecture: Operating Manual for the Self-Organizing City’ published by Rutledge in 2011 was co authored by Claudia Pasquero and Marco Poletto.

TIA KANSARADirectorKansara Hackney Ltd
Community Architecture Workshop: How Entrepreneurship Will Lead Communities out of Poverty
Kansara Hackney Ltd (KH) aims to alleviate poverty through community architecture, which began when one of the two directors, Dr Rod Hackney, realized that the root of the sustainability debate lay in tapping neglected human potential. To satisfy the UN-Habitat alleviation of slum conditions, KH involves local slum dwellers with professional enablers, who live and work within the shantytowns, through a self-help programme of renovation and social improvement.
The slum-energizing programme began in 1971 with Dr Hackney’s house in Black Road, which like 1.5 million other UK homes, was classified by the government as "unfit for human habitation". Community Architecture’s role in resisting the inevitable demolition of houses and championing of an alternative sustainable self-build programme, involves all slum residents. Join the KH team and learn how to set-up your own Community Architecture Project. We work through the tools necessary, pit-falls and numerous examples to get your show on the road!
Tia is an award-winning director of Kansara Hackney Ltd. In 2010, she wrote the brief and appointed the architects Foster+Partners for SAMBA‘s multi-million dollar headquarters, as the first female to judge a LEED platinum building in Saudi Arabia. She’s on London Business School Global Energy Summit’s executive committee, Co-director of the international CleanTechChallenge, the Gulf ambassador of the UCL Bartlett, Siemen’s list of Future Influencers and Global Ambassador of the Sandbox Network.
Currently completing her Ph.D. at UCL on designing future cities whilst creating the first energy baseline in the Gulf.
Rod Hackney's Inner City objective is a simple one. Only by living in slums can professionals and communities efficiently work together to overcome crowded, dirty, and run-down environments. His successful results alleviated poverty, halted social decay, degradation and riots, whilst creating sustainable jobs, recycling waste, reducing harmful emissions and producing green environments. His slum upgrading skills were acknowledged by the Paris based Union Internationale des Architectes (UIA). The UIA Sir Robert Mathew Prize citation stated that Rod Hackney’s "work represents an extremely innovative approach to community architecture. Here, as a member of the community, the architect assumes the role of organizer and teacher, helping people to improve their own living environment. The technology transfer is part of a process in community design and reconstruction”.
